Heavy Equipment Operator

Description

Avail Valley Construction is seeking a skilled and safety‑focused Heavy Equipment Operator to join our team. This position is ideal for someone who takes pride in their work, operates machinery with precision, and contributes to a productive and safe jobsite environment. The ideal candidate will have experience operating various types of heavy construction equipment and be committed to maintaining high standards of workmanship.

 

As a Heavy Equipment Operator, you will be responsible for safely operating equipment such as excavators, loaders, graders, dozers, and skid steers. You’ll support excavation, grading, trenching, road building, utility installation, and other civil construction activities. You will also be responsible for performing daily equipment inspections, reporting maintenance needs, and helping maintain a clean and organized work area.

Key Responsibilities 

  • Safely operate heavy equipment including excavators, loaders, graders, and dozers

  • Perform excavation, grading, trenching, and material handling tasks

  • Follow site plans, grade stakes, and directions from supervisors

  • Conduct daily equipment inspections and document findings

  • Report mechanical issues and assist with basic equipment maintenance

  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work environment

  • Follow all company safety policies and regulations

  • Work collaboratively with crew members and supervisors

  • Assist with labor tasks when equipment operation is not required

​

Qualifications

  • Experience operating heavy construction equipment

  • Strong commitment to safety and quality

  • Ability to read grade stakes and follow directions

  • Reliable, punctual, and team‑oriented work ethic

  • Willingness to perform physical labor as needed

Trucking Superintendent/Dispatch 

Description

Avail Valley Construction is seeking an experienced Trucking Superintendent/Dispatch professional to oversee and manage all aspects of our fleet operations, dispatch coordination, and regulatory compliance. This leadership role requires extensive knowledge of FMCSA/DOT regulations, contract management, and construction logistics.

Key Responsibilities 

Fleet Management & Dispatch Operations 

  • Oversee daily dispatch operations for all company-owned and subcontracted vehicles 

  • Coordinate trucking schedules to ensure timely delivery of materials and equipment to construction sites 

  • Optimize routing and load planning to maximize efficiency and minimize costs 

  • Maintain real-time communication with drivers regarding schedules, routes, and job site requirements 

  • Monitor fleet performance metrics including on-time delivery rates, fuel efficiency, and equipment utilization 

  • Manage relationships with vendors, suppliers, and third-party carriers 

​

FMCSA/DOT Compliance & Safety 

  • Ensure full compliance with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) regulations (49 CFR Parts 382, 383, 390-399) 

  • Maintain DOT compliance for all commercial motor vehicles and drivers 

  • Oversee Hours of Service (HOS) compliance and Electronic Logging Device (ELD) implementation 

  • Manage driver qualification files (DQF) and ensure all required documentation is current 

  • Coordinate and maintain Drug and Alcohol Testing Program (49 CFR Part 382) 

  • Conduct regular safety audits and implement corrective action plans 

  • Ensure proper vehicle inspections (DVIR - Driver Vehicle Inspection Reports) 

  • Maintain accident reporting procedures and manage post-accident investigations 

  • Oversee implementation of company safety policies and driver training programs 

  • Maintain DOT Safety Rating and work to improve CSA (Compliance, Safety, Accountability) scores
